

Vpn推荐 github:github上值得关注的开源vpn项目和指南 2026版是一份全面、实用且最新的指南,帮助你在 GitHub 上发现值得关注的开源 VPN 项目、理解各种实现方式,以及选择最合适的 VPN 方案。下面这份内容会带你从基础概念、常用开源 VPN 解决方案,到实际部署、安全性评估与未来趋势,逐步掌握核心要点。作为一个教育平台的教学视频脚本,本篇以清晰、可操作的结构呈现,方便你直接上手或用于视频讲解。
快速事实小结
- 开源 VPN 的核心价值在于透明度、可审计性和自定义能力,而非单纯的商业闭源实现。
- GitHub 上热门的开源 VPN 项目通常涵盖自建 VPN、分流代理、ODP/WireGuard 配置、以及企业级解决方案。
- 选择合适的协议和实现,需要结合你的设备支持、网络环境、日志策略与维护频率。
- 安全性评估应关注代码活跃度、社区参与度、漏洞披露与修复时效。
目录
- 为什么要关注开源 VPN 项目
- Github 上值得关注的开源 VPN 项目概览
- 关键协议与实现原理
- 部署场景与实用清单
- 安全性与合规性要点
- 性能与可扩展性考量
- 使用与维护的实用技巧
- FAQ 常见问题
Vpn推荐 github:github上值得关注的开源vpn项目和指南 2026版的核心要点在于帮助你快速定位高质量的开源 VPN 项目,并理解如何在多种场景下落地。无论你是个人用户、教育机构,还是小型团队,下面的内容都能给你一个清晰的路线图。为了让你更容易消化,我们会用清单、对比表与步骤指南等多种格式来呈现。
Useful resources and URLs (文本格式、不可点击)
- Apple Website – apple.com
- Artificial Intelligence Wikipedia – en.wikipedia.org/wiki/Artificial_intelligence
- Linux Kernel Archives – kernel.org
- WireGuard 官方文档 – www.wireguard.com
- OpenVPN 官方文档 – openvpn.net
- GitHub 开源 VPN 仓库总览 – github.com
- NIST VPN 安全指南 – nist.gov
- CVE 铭记与漏洞披露统计 – cve.mitre.org
- Cloudflare 安全最佳实践 – bredr.space (示例文本,用作格式参照)
- 互联网自由与隐私组织 – privacy.org
为什么要关注开源 VPN 项目
- 透明度和可审计性:开源代码可以被审计、复查安全隐患,降低被捆绑后门的风险。
- 自定义与可控性:你可以根据需求裁剪功能、加入自定义策略、改造成企业级解决方案。
- 社区与生态:活跃的社区意味着更快的漏洞修复、文档更新和新功能迭代。
- 学习与研究价值:了解 VPN 的底层实现、加密协议、网络隧道技术,有助于提升网络安全素养。
Github 上值得关注的开源 VPN 项目概览
下列项目覆盖不同层面的需求,从轻量自建到企业级解决方案,适合学习与落地实施。
- WireGuard
- 说明:现代、高性能的 VPN 协议实现,以简洁和强安全性著称。
- 适用场景:家庭、小型企业、需要高性能的隧道。
- 主要特点:基于现代加密、极简设计、跨平台支持广泛。
- OpenVPN
- 说明:老牌稳健的 VPN 实现,功能丰富、生态成熟。
- 适用场景:对兼容性和可配置性有高要求的场景。
- 主要特点:广泛平台支持、灵活的认证和访问控制。
- Algo VPN(简化部署版本)
- 说明:旨在快速在云端部署的简易 VPN 方案,强调隐私与易用性。
- 适用场景:个人快速搭建、学习与演示。
- 主要特点:一键部署、最小化暴露面、默认安全设置。
- Stunnel + SSH 隧道组合
- 说明:通过加密隧道实现代理,适合防火墙受限场景。
- 适用场景:需要穿透严格防火墙或代理环境。
- 主要特点:灵活性高、部署成本低。
- Outline Server(现状与替代方案)
- 说明:以前流行的代理解决方案,当前版本与社区维护状态需关注。
- 适用场景:教育演示、学习代理配置。
- 主要特点:易于上手、可视化管理界面。
注:以上仅为示意性项目集合,实际在 GitHub 上的活跃度、维护状态需以最近的仓库信息为准。请以最近 6–12 个月的提交记录、Issue/PR 活跃度为判定标准。
关键协议与实现原理
- WireGuard
- 原理:基于快速且现代的加密构造,使用简单的对等(peer)配置。
- 优点:极高的性能、代码量小、审计简便。
- 典型部署步骤:生成密钥对、配置接口、创建对等节点、路由设置。
- OpenVPN
- 原理:基于 SSL/TLS 的加密隧道,提供多种模式(点对点、服务器-客户端、站点对站点)。
- 优点:兼容性强、丰富的认证方法。
- 典型部署步骤:搭建服务端、生成证书、配置客户端、证书信任链管理。
- Stunnel/SSH 隧道
- 原理:通过 TLS 隧道封装其他协议,常用于绕过限制。
- 优点:部署灵活、对现有代理友好。
- 典型部署步骤:搭建 Stunnel 配置、创建密钥、设定转发规则。
部署场景与实用清单
- 家庭/个人使用
- 目标:提升隐私、访问受限内容、保护公共 Wi-Fi。
- 建议:优先考虑 WireGuard 方案,搭建成本低、性能优越。
- 步骤简述:
- 选择一台设备作为服务器(家用路由器、树莓派、云服务器)。
- 安装 WireGuard 服务端与客户端。
- 配置防火墙与端口转发。
- 测试连通性与速度。
- 小型企业
- 目标:安全的远程工作访问、分支机构互联。
- 建议:OpenVPN 或 WireGuard 组合方案,结合统一身份认证(如 OAuth2/OIDC)。
- 步骤简述:
- 部署集中管理(如管理面板/脚本)。
- 设定多因认证。
- 进行日志与审计策略配置。
- 机构/教育机构
- 目标:全网可控访问、合规性审计、可观测性。
- 建议:结合 OpenVPN + 认证代理,搭配集中日志分析。
- 步骤简述:
- 使用集中身份管理。
- 部署多节点、自动化证书轮换。
- 设置数据脱敏与访问分级。
安全性与合规性要点
- 审计与日志
- 尽量实现最小权限日志,保留访问元数据但避免收集敏感内容。
- 设置日志轮换与加密存储,定期审查权限。
- 密钥管理
- 使用强密钥、定期轮换,避免长期使用同一密钥。
- 对密钥进行分离存放(服务器端与客户端私钥分离)。
- 认证与访问控制
- 优先使用多因素认证、OIDC、SAML 等现代方法。
- 对不同用户设定最小权限原则。
- 漏洞管理
- 关注仓库的 Issue/PR 活动,关注 CVE 报告与修复时效。
- 建立自有漏洞披露流程,鼓励团队成员提交安全改进。
- 合规性
- 遵循本地隐私法规与数据传输规范,确保跨境数据传输符合规定。
- 对外部协作时,签订安全和数据处理条款。
性能与可扩展性考量
- 协议选择对性能影响显著
- WireGuard 在延迟敏感场景表现优越,适合高带宽需求。
- OpenVPN 在兼容性复杂网络环境下具韧性,但可能稍慢。
- 服务器硬件与网络
- CPU 能力对加密解密影响大,建议使用支持增强指令集的 CPU。
- 网络带宽与上行下行比对,确保路由器/服务器能承受峰值流量。
- 多节点与分布式架构
- 若用户规模增大,考虑多节点部署,使用负载均衡、流量分流与监控。
使用与维护的实用技巧
- 学习曲线平滑
- 先从 WireGuard 入手,快速搭建一个测试环境,熟悉对等配置与路由。
- 自动化运维
- 使用自动化脚本来生成客户端配置、证书轮换、备份与恢复。
- 监控与告警
- 针对 VPN 连接数、认证失败率、延迟、丢包等设定阈值与告警。
- 备份与灾难恢复
- 备份服务器配置、密钥对与证书,设定定期演练恢复流程。
- 文档与培训
- 将部署步骤和安全措施整理成可分享的文档,方便团队成员学习与排错。
常见对比表(简表)
-
WireGuard vs OpenVPN
- 性能:WireGuard 高
- 安装复杂度:WireGuard 低,OpenVPN 高
- 兼容性:OpenVPN 广泛,WireGuard 逐步完善
- 安全性:两者都高,WireGuard 设计上更简洁
- 适用场景:个人/家庭适合 WireGuard;企业/混合环境可选 OpenVPN
-
Algo VPN vs 传统 OpenVPN
- 部署难度:Algo VPN 简单
- 安全性:Algo 预设保守更安全,但灵活性较低
- 使用场景:学习与快速部署、小型场景
- 维护性:Algo 更易维护,但社区活跃度不同
使用示例与步骤(以 WireGuard 为核心的简易部署)
- 步骤 1:准备工作
- 选择服务器(家庭路由器、树莓派、VPS)
- 确认端口开放与防火墙策略
- 步骤 2:安装 WireGuard
- 在服务器端安装 WireGuard,生成私钥/公钥
- 在客户端生成密钥对
- 步骤 3:配置对等节点
- 服务器端配置对等条目,允许客户端隧道
- 客户端配置私钥、对等端点与公钥
- 步骤 4:路由与防火墙
- 设置转发、NAT、端口转发
- 步骤 5:测试与优化
- 连接测试、速度测试、日志审查
- 根据需要进行 QoS、MTU 调整
技术趋势与未来展望
- 轻量化与集成化
- 越来越多的设备原生支持 WireGuard,集成度提升,部署更便捷。
- 更强的可观测性
- 通过分布式追踪、集中日志平台,提升对 VPN 流量与安全态势的洞察。
- 以隐私为中心的默认设置
- 默认开启最小日志、最小数据收集,提升用户信任。
Frequently Asked Questions
VPN 的开源意义为何重要?
开源让代码透明、可审计,减少隐私和安全风险,同时让社区共同维护、改进。 如何自建梯子:完整指南與實用技巧,提升上網自由與安全性
WireGuard 和 OpenVPN 的差异在哪里?
WireGuard 性能更高、代码简单、配置直观;OpenVPN 功能强大、兼容性广、对复杂网络环境更友好。
部署一个家庭 VPN 的成本大致是多少?
取决于硬件选择与云服务价格。自建本地服务器成本低、但维护需要时间。云端方案则按月计费,灵活性高。
如何评估一个开源 VPN 项目的活跃度?
查看最近 6–12 个月的提交记录、Issue/PR 的处理速度、社区响应和文档是否更新。
使用 VPN 会影响我的上网速度吗?
可能会有一定程度的性能损耗,取决于协议、加密强度、服务器位置与网络条件。合理选择协议与服务器可最小化影响。
安全性方面,应该关注哪些指标?
证书管理、密钥轮换策略、认证方式、日志策略、漏洞披露与修复速度。 Ios好用的vpn推荐:多功能、安全、易用的最佳選擇與實用比較
我应该为家庭网络选哪种协议?
若追求简单、高效,WireGuard 是优选;若需要更丰富的兼容性或特定企业需求,可以考虑 OpenVPN。
如何在企业环境中实现合规的 VPN 使用?
结合统一身份认证、细粒度访问控制、审计日志与数据保护策略,确保符合本地法规。
非技术人员如何理解 VPN 的工作原理?
VPN 就像给你上网的“专用管道”,把你的数据通过加密堵塞在外部网络,防止别人偷窥。
如果我的 ISP 阻塞某些端口,该怎么办?
尝试使用不同的端口、或切换到更隐蔽的传输方式(如 TLS 揭示、混淆等),但需遵守当地法律与网络使用政策。
注:以上内容仅供学习与参考。实际部署请以最新的官方文档、仓库说明和安全最佳实践为准。本文旨在帮助你了解开源 VPN 的核心概念、常见项目与落地策略,方便你在视频中以清晰的步骤和直观的对比进行讲解。 加速器vpn破解版:免费背后的风险与安全上网之道
Sources:
How to connect multiple devices nordvpn 2026: NordVPN Multi-Device Setup Guide
Claash VPN 全面解析:Claash 如何提升你的上网隐私与速度
Le guide ultime pour le streaming sans limites avec nordvpn et d’autres astuces VPN
